> > Actually, I think Ardour3 would be ideal for this, as you can easily
> > work with MIDI piano roll and audio waveforms right on the same screen
> > (most sequencers open MIDI piano roll up into a separate window). As
> > you can see in this screenshot, you have everything right in front of
> > you and its easy to set synch points for both audio and MIDI:
>
> It looks really promising. I didn't know Ardour could do that. I'm going
> to try with my current Ardour (2.8). If the feature is not there I will
> upgrade and try again.
>
>
You need Ardour3, Ardour2 doesn't support MIDI sequencing.
